The Graduate Certificate in Fashion Logistics and Supply Chain Management is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to succeed in the fashion industry's complex logistics and supply chain management landscape.
This program focuses on teaching students how to manage the flow of goods, services, and information from raw materials to end customers, with an emphasis on the fashion industry's unique challenges and opportunities.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to analyze and solve problems related to fashion logistics and supply chain management, and develop strategies to improve efficiency, reduce costs, and enhance customer satisfaction.
The program covers a range of topics, including fashion merchandising, fashion marketing, fashion design, and global supply chain management, as well as logistics and transportation management, inventory management, and supply chain risk management.
The Graduate Certificate in Fashion Logistics and Supply Chain Management is typically completed in one year, with students taking two courses per semester.
The program is designed to be flexible and accessible, with online and on-campus options available to accommodate different learning styles and schedules.
